CHRISTMAS IN THE BLACK
Tyler Morning Telegraph, December 9, 2006 by Lindsay Randall
Put down the reams of red-and-green lights. Set aside the credit card, stop flouring the cake pan, and take a break from holiday madness. Schoolteacher and wallet-watcher April Coker is here with a few stress-saving tips for the Christmas season.
"Don't ignore garage sales and thrift stores," she warns. "Earmark money early in the year and start saving."
